My Boyfriend applied for citizenship. He is a permanent resident in NJ. He went for the interview an pass the exams. The officer informed him that he needed more documents and to have them submitted by a specific time frame, in which he did, after some time we received a letter that his application was denied. What do we do now. Do we have to fill out the application all over again and pay the application fee. If I am not mistaken about a year and a half has passed since we received the letter of denial. Could we file an appeal, if so which form do I use. Thanks a bunch.
 
They asked him for a deposition, for an arrest that he had on his record. The charges were dropped. And they also wanted a receipt from the Canadian/US border.

Generally you have to file an appeal within a certain period of the denial. The letter should state that. If the window has passed then your boy friend has to file again.

In either case consult a good lawyer before you do anything.
 
Would we have to pay the fee again. Also would he have to do fingerprints an the exams again? Would the first application have an affect on the second one?
 
Yes refiling is just like intial application same fees and process.Ia m sure they will reference you old file since you are in Database..Good lawyer is a way to go.
 
In absence of knowing more about the circumstances of his denial, its hard to speculate when he should apply again. Take the denial letter to a good lawyer and discuss the options with them.

A year and a half is definitely too long a wait to be eligible for an appeal. Generally these have to be requested within a relatively short timeframe (~30days?). So yes, your only option is to reapply and pay another $400, then get fingerprinted over again etc, etc.
